The 'Conscience of Europe?'

Navigating Shifting Tides at the European Court of Human Rights

Más información sobre el libro

The ‘Conscience of Europe?’ examines the European Court of Human Rights’ sometimes unpredictable jurisprudence in the increasingly controversial areas of marriage, family, sanctity of human life, and religious freedom. With a palpable concern for human rights and religious freedom, the contributors provide an objective critique of the Court’s role, while exploring the changes recent years have brought to the complex legal landscape of Europe. “This manual provides useful keys for unlocking the important, but complex, jurisprudence of Europe’s highest human rights court.” - Judge Borrego Borrego, Former Judge of the European Court of Human Rights
